Your problem is much more likely to be a totally local problem due to
a windows corruption then one just caused by the Bat.
Try producing that same error on a different machine and then you have
a better idea if its computer specific or not.
And then the real problem can still be windows, Eudora or the bat or
even another program.
If you had made an export of the registry before and after
the mess produced and then run a comparison between them (several
programs will do that) , then very likely with a bit of luck maybe a
very limited number of changes would be found, indicating what the
problem could be.
Registry problems cannot be  easily be analysed long distance.
And the best person to find the essential facts is with the computer it
runs on, ie you.
This is not trying to tell you to fix it yourself.
But try finding whats changed and then you may get a useful answer.
